以下是一个简单的实例,展示了如何使用PHP来开发一个基于谷歌游戏的简单应用程序。

实例:谷歌游戏API集成到PHP应用

1. 安装PHP和谷歌游戏API库

确保你的服务器上安装了PHP。然后,你可以使用以下命令来安装谷歌游戏API库:

实例谷歌游戏PHP,实例谷歌游戏PHP开发指南  第1张

```bash

composer require google/apiclient

```

2. 配置API密钥

在谷歌云控制台中创建一个新的API密钥,并授予它访问谷歌游戏的权限。

3. PHP代码示例

以下是一个简单的PHP脚本,用于验证用户身份并获取谷歌游戏用户的ID。

```php

require 'vendor/autoload.php';

// 初始化API客户端

$client = new Google_Client();

$client->setAuthConfig('path/to/client_secret.json');

$client->addScope(Google_Service_Games::GAMES);

// 获取访问令牌

if (isset($_GET['code'])) {

$client->authenticate($_GET['code']);

$client->setAccessToken($_SESSION['access_token']);

// 获取用户ID

$games = new Google_Service_Games($client);

$userProfile = $games->players->get($_SESSION['user_id']);

echo "